My ignition key switch continues to turn when you go to start the car. Is there a star washer or something that locks it down.

jerry
BJ8
 
Are you saying the whole switch rotates? The threaded shaft of the switch has a notch in it and the chrome bezel it fits into is shaped like a "D".

You only did half a job, what about drawing the chrome escutcheon / switch plate that the switch fits in :thumbsup: fitted on the bj8, this has the same cutout shape as Greg's drawing shows. So in theory the switch should only be able to rotate a little.

If its the right switch, being a model 47sa part number 31973k.

yes a star washer might help, I think it should have a thin metal spring plate washer as standard, between the switch and plate, with the bezel fitted on the front of the plate.

cheers Andy
 
Well, that might explain it. It is not the original switch and the center console had some adjustments to it. I will have to check, but I think someone changed the D to and O.

The good news: I have the D in the panel. I found the original ignition and swapped the key slot. Problem solved.
